Coconut oil monolaurin has shown some effectiveness in combating bacterial infections, as it has antimicrobial properties that can help fight off certain types of bacteria. However, more research is needed to fully understand its effectiveness and potential applications in treating bacterial infections.

What diseases are treated with antibiotics?

Antibiotics are used to treat bacterial infections such as strep throat, urinary tract infections, and bacterial pneumonia. They are not effective against viral infections like the common cold or flu.

What does penasillin cure?

Penicillin is an antibiotic that is effective in treating bacterial infections such as strep throat, pneumonia, syphilis, and certain skin infections. It is not effective against viral infections like the common cold or flu.


Is the use of antibiotics an effective treatment for viral infections?

No, antibiotics are not effective in treating viral infections. Antibiotics only work against bacterial infections, not viruses. Treating a viral infection typically involves antiviral medications, rest, and supportive care.
